Walk into most small manufacturing operations and you'll find the same scene: a whiteboard covered in job numbers, a stack of paper job sheets on the supervisor's desk, and a shared Excel file that three people are trying to update simultaneously.

It works. Until it doesn't.

The problem with manual process management isn't that it fails dramatically — it's that it fails slowly, invisibly, and expensively.

The Hidden Costs of Manual Tracking

Warranty disputes you can't win. A customer claims a product failed within the warranty period. You have no digital record of when it was manufactured, what batch it came from, or what quality checks were performed. You either absorb the cost or damage the relationship. Either way, you lose.

Quality issues that repeat. A defect appears in your production line. Without a searchable record of which products were affected, which batch they came from, and which process step introduced the problem, you're guessing. The same issue appears again three months later.

Time lost to record-hunting. Your team spends hours each week searching through paper files, old Excel sheets, and WhatsApp message histories to answer basic questions: When was this unit serviced? What parts were used? Is this still under warranty? This time has a direct cost.

Onboarding new staff takes too long. Your processes live in the heads of your experienced workers and in filing cabinets that only they know how to navigate. When someone leaves or you hire someone new, institutional knowledge walks out the door.

Compliance and audit risk. If your industry requires documentation of quality checks, production records, or service history, paper-based systems create real compliance risk. Audits become stressful events rather than routine checks.

Why Most Small Manufacturers Haven't Fixed This Yet

The honest answer is that enterprise manufacturing software is built for companies ten times their size. It's expensive, complex to implement, and requires dedicated IT support to maintain. The ROI calculation doesn't work for a 20-person operation.

So they stick with Excel. And Excel keeps working — just well enough to avoid forcing a change, but not well enough to actually support growth.

The Transition Doesn't Have to Be Painful

The biggest fear most manufacturers have about switching systems is the migration. Years of data sitting in spreadsheets, paper files, and people's heads.

The reality is that you don't need to migrate everything at once. Start with new production going forward. Build the digital record from today. The old data can be migrated gradually, or simply archived.

Within weeks, your team has a live, searchable system. Within months, the old way of working feels like a distant memory.
